There are sleep in atomic bug that could cause kernel panic during
firmware download process. The root cause is that nlmsg_new with
GFP_KERNEL parameter is called in fw_dnld_timeout which is a timer
handler. The call trace is shown below:
BUG: sleeping function called from invalid context at include/linux/sched/mm.h:265
Call Trace:
kmem_cache_alloc_node
__alloc_skb
nfc_genl_fw_download_done
call_timer_fn
__run_timers.part.0
run_timer_softirq
__do_softirq
...
The nlmsg_new with GFP_KERNEL parameter may sleep during memory
allocation process, and the timer handler is run as the result of
a "software interrupt" that should not call any other function
that could sleep.
This patch changes allocation mode of netlink message from GFP_KERNEL
to GFP_ATOMIC in order to prevent sleep in atomic bug. The GFP_ATOMIC
flag makes memory allocation operation could be used in atomic context.

This patch addresses an issue seen where SCHED_FIFO prio 99
tasks were being woken up on a cpu where a long-running softirq
was executing, and the RT task was not being migrated, causing
long (10+ms wakeup latencies).
Prior to upstream commit 934fc3314b ("sched/cpupri: Remap
CPUPRI_NORMAL to MAX_RT_PRIO-1") the task->prio -> cpupri
mapping is a little ackward.
For RT tasks, its calculated as:
cpupri = MAX_RT_PRIO - prio + 1;
See:
https://android.googlesource.com/kernel/common/+/refs/heads/android13-5.10/kernel/sched/cpupri.c#39
This is added ontop of the also ackward detail that the
task->prio is inverted (RT prio99 -> 0), means the cpupri
mapping for RT tasks goes from 2->101. This makes it easy to
evaluate the cpupri incorrectly.
Which it turns out happened In commit 3adfd8e344 ("ANDROID:
sched: avoid placing RT threads on cores handling softirqs"):
3adfd8e344%5E%21/
With the lines:
int task_pri = convert_prio(p->prio);
bool drop_nopreempts = task_pri <= MAX_RT_PRIO;
Where the added logic to decide to migrate a rt task off of a
cpu depended on this drop_nopreempts being true.
This works properly for rt tasks from prio 99 to 1, but for the
case of task->prio == 0 (userland rt prio 99 tasks) it breaks,
as the cpupri will be MAX_RT_PRIO - 0 + 1, which then gets
checked as <= MAX_RT_PRIO.
This prevents the cpu from being dropped from the scheduling
set and prevents the rt user prio 99 task from migrating, which
results in high priority rt tasks being left on cpus where long
running softirqs are executing, causing long latencies.
This patch fixes the off by one by changing the evaulation
to MAX_RT_PRIO + 1, so that user-prio 99 tasks will also be
migrated if appropriate.
Luckilly this odd cpupri mapping has been fixed upstream, making
this patch no longer necessary in 5.15 and newer kernels.

GZIP-compressed files end with 4 byte data that represents the size
of the original input. The decompressors (the self-extracting kernel)
exploit it to know the vmlinux size beforehand. To mimic the GZIP's
trailer, Kbuild provides cmd_{bzip2,lzma,lzo,lz4,xzkern,zstd22}.
Unfortunately these macros are used everywhere despite the appended
size data is only useful for the decompressors.
There is no guarantee that such hand-crafted trailers are safely ignored.
In fact, the kernel refuses compressed initramdfs with the garbage data.
That is why usr/Makefile overrides size_append to make it no-op.
To limit the use of such broken compressed files, this commit renames
the existing macros as follows:
cmd_bzip2 --> cmd_bzip2_with_size
cmd_lzma --> cmd_lzma_with_size
cmd_lzo --> cmd_lzo_with_size
cmd_lz4 --> cmd_lz4_with_size
cmd_xzkern --> cmd_xzkern_with_size
cmd_zstd22 --> cmd_zstd22_with_size
To keep the decompressors working, I updated the following Makefiles
accordingly:
arch/arm/boot/compressed/Makefile
arch/h8300/boot/compressed/Makefile
arch/mips/boot/compressed/Makefile
arch/parisc/boot/compressed/Makefile
arch/s390/boot/compressed/Makefile
arch/sh/boot/compressed/Makefile
arch/x86/boot/compressed/Makefile
I reused the current macro names for the normal usecases; they produce
the compressed data in the proper format.
I did not touch the following:
arch/arc/boot/Makefile
arch/arm64/boot/Makefile
arch/csky/boot/Makefile
arch/mips/boot/Makefile
arch/riscv/boot/Makefile
arch/sh/boot/Makefile
kernel/Makefile
This means those Makefiles will stop appending the size data.
I dropped the 'override size_append' hack from usr/Makefile.

The following deadlocks have been observed on multiple test setups:
* ufshcd_wl_suspend() is waiting for blk_execute_rq() to complete while it
holds host_sem.
* ufshcd_eh_host_reset_handler() invokes ufshcd_err_handler() and the
latter function tries to obtain host_sem.
This is a deadlock because blk_execute_rq() can't execute SCSI commands
while the host is in the SHOST_RECOVERY state and because the error
handler cannot make progress either.
* ufshcd_wl_runtime_resume() is waiting for blk_execute_rq() to finish
while it holds host_sem.
* ufshcd_eh_host_reset_handler() invokes ufshcd_err_handler() and the
latter function calls pm_runtime_resume().
This is a deadlock because of the same reason as the previous scenario.
Fix both deadlocks by not obtaining host_sem from the power management
code paths. Removing the host_sem locking from the power management code
is safe because the ufshcd_err_handler() is already serialized against
SCSI command execution.

Sound is broken on the DragonBoard 410c (apq8016_sbc) since 5.10:
hdmi-audio-codec hdmi-audio-codec.1.auto: ASoC: error at snd_soc_component_set_jack on hdmi-audio-codec.1.auto: -95
qcom-apq8016-sbc 7702000.sound: Failed to set jack: -95
ADV7533: ASoC: error at snd_soc_link_init on ADV7533: -95
hdmi-audio-codec hdmi-audio-codec.1.auto: ASoC: error at snd_soc_component_set_jack on hdmi-audio-codec.1.auto: -95
qcom-apq8016-sbc: probe of 7702000.sound failed with error -95
This happens because apq8016_sbc calls snd_soc_component_set_jack() on
all codec DAIs and attempts to ignore failures with return code -ENOTSUPP.
-ENOTSUPP is also excluded from error logging in soc_component_ret().
However, hdmi_codec_set_jack() returns -E*OP*NOTSUPP if jack detection
is not supported, which is not handled in apq8016_sbc and soc_component_ret().
Make it return -ENOTSUPP instead to fix sound and silence the errors.

pipe_resize_ring() needs to take the pipe->rd_wait.lock spinlock to
prevent post_one_notification() from trying to insert into the ring
whilst the ring is being replaced.
The occupancy check must be done after the lock is taken, and the lock
must be taken after the new ring is allocated.
The bug can lead to an oops looking something like:
BUG: KASAN: use-after-free in post_one_notification.isra.0+0x62e/0x840
Read of size 4 at addr ffff88801cc72a70 by task poc/27196
...
Call Trace:
post_one_notification.isra.0+0x62e/0x840
__post_watch_notification+0x3b7/0x650
key_create_or_update+0xb8b/0xd20
__do_sys_add_key+0x175/0x340
__x64_sys_add_key+0xbe/0x140
do_syscall_64+0x5c/0xc0
entry_SYSCALL_64_after_hwframe+0x44/0xae

Whenever x86_decode_emulated_instruction() detects a breakpoint, it
returns the value that kvm_vcpu_check_breakpoint() writes into its
pass-by-reference second argument. Unfortunately this is completely
bogus because the expected outcome of x86_decode_emulated_instruction
is an EMULATION_* value.
Then, if kvm_vcpu_check_breakpoint() does "*r = 0" (corresponding to
a KVM_EXIT_DEBUG userspace exit), it is misunderstood as EMULATION_OK
and x86_emulate_instruction() is called without having decoded the
instruction. This causes various havoc from running with a stale
emulation context.
The fix is to move the call to kvm_vcpu_check_breakpoint() where it was
before commit 4aa2691dcb ("KVM: x86: Factor out x86 instruction
emulation with decoding") introduced x86_decode_emulated_instruction().
The other caller of the function does not need breakpoint checks,
because it is invoked as part of a vmexit and the processor has already
checked those before executing the instruction that #GP'd.
This fixes CVE-2022-1852.

To avoid changing the visibiliy of data types when including
hook definition headers remove header file inclusions from
the hook definition header files.
Instead, the hook definition headers should just have forward
declarations that don't require full definition.
To provide full definitions of the types for the KMI, the
headers that define the types should be included by the
source file that instantiates the hooks - normally
vendor_hooks.c.
Since the KMI is frozen, some of the inclusions are still
required to preserve the CRC associated with symbols. Keep
these inclusions under #ifdef __GENKSYMS__.
This patch results in 17 fewer opaque types in the KMI
(80 vs 97). Of the remaining 80 opaque types, 50 are
defined in C files (and therefore are truly opaque and
cannot be used by vendor modules). That leaves 30
types that still need definition in the KMI.

When the pipe is closed, we mark the associated watchqueue defunct by
calling watch_queue_clear(). However, while that is protected by the
watchqueue lock, new watchqueue entries aren't actually added under that
lock at all: they use the pipe->rd_wait.lock instead, and looking up
that pipe happens without any locking.
The watchqueue code uses the RCU read-side section to make sure that the
wqueue entry itself hasn't disappeared, but that does not protect the
pipe_info in any way.
So make sure to actually hold the wqueue lock when posting watch events,
properly serializing against the pipe being torn down.
